为什么这个“替换你的技术栈”的产品可能会失败
我正在构建一个工具,旨在替代常见的单人创始人工具组合:<p>客户关系管理(CRM)、电子邮件及跟进、预约、着陆页、社交媒体排程、轻量级自动化。<p>其中一些工具已经存在,我每天都在使用(CRM + 社交媒体 + 简单的冷邮件)。这并不是一个纯粹的概念。<p>我认为这个项目可能失败的原因有:<p>说“替代你的工具组合”会立即杀死信任感;<p>对于大多数人来说,切换成本超过了挫败感;<p>用户会根据最弱的替代品来评判整个产品;<p>尤其是电子邮件,想让人们转移使用非常困难;<p>受众广泛,期望差异很大;<p>现有产品定义了基准,而不是用户的投诉;<p>我发布这个内容是为了尽早消灭不好的想法。<p>你认为这些问题中哪个是致命的?我低估了什么?

i’m building a tool that tries to replace a common solo-founder stack:<p>crm, email + follow-ups, booking, landing pages, social scheduling, light automation.<p>some of it already exists and i use it daily (crm + social + simple cold email). this isn’t a pure concept.<p>reasons i think this probably fails:<p>saying “replace your stack” instantly kills trust<p>switching costs beat frustration for most people<p>users judge the whole product by the weakest replacement<p>email is especially hard to get people to move<p>the audience is broad and expectations vary a lot<p>incumbents define the baseline, not user complaints<p>i’m posting this to kill bad ideas early.<p>which of these do you think is fatal?
what am i underestimating?
